Our stock screening tool has identified OMEGA HEALTHCARE INVESTORS (NYSE:OHI) as a strong dividend contender with robust fundamentals. NYSE:OHI exhibits commendable financial health and profitability, all while offering a sustainable dividend. Let's delve into each aspect below.

Evaluating Dividend: NYSE:OHI

ChartMill assigns a proprietary Dividend Rating to each stock. The score is computed by evaluating various valuation aspects, like the yield, the history, the dividend growth and sustainability. NYSE:OHI was assigned a score of 8 for dividend:

  • OHI has a Yearly Dividend Yield of 8.78%, which is a nice return.
  • Compared to an average industry Dividend Yield of 6.17, OHI pays a better dividend. On top of this OHI pays more dividend than 84.38% of the companies listed in the same industry.
  • OHI's Dividend Yield is rather good when compared to the S&P500 average which is at 2.55.
  • OHI has been paying a dividend for at least 10 years, so it has a reliable track record.
  • OHI has not decreased its dividend for at least 10 years, so it has a reliable track record of non decreasing dividend.
  • OHI's earnings are growing more than its dividend. This makes the dividend growth sustainable.

How We Gauge Health for NYSE:OHI

Every stock is evaluated by ChartMill, receiving a Health Rating on a scale of 0 to 10. This assessment considers different health aspects, including liquidity and solvency, both in absolute terms and relative to industry peers. NYSE:OHI has achieved a 5 out of 10:

  • With a decent Debt to FCF ratio value of 19.37, OHI is doing good in the industry, outperforming 71.09% of the companies in the same industry.
  • A Current Ratio of 2.89 indicates that OHI has no problem at all paying its short term obligations.
  • OHI has a better Current ratio (2.89) than 89.06% of its industry peers.
  • OHI has a Quick Ratio of 2.89. This indicates that OHI is financially healthy and has no problem in meeting its short term obligations.
  • OHI has a better Quick ratio (2.89) than 89.06% of its industry peers.

How do we evaluate the Profitability for NYSE:OHI?

ChartMill employs its own Profitability Rating system for stock evaluation. This score, ranging from 0 to 10, is derived from an analysis of diverse profitability metrics and margins. In the case of NYSE:OHI, the assigned 7 is noteworthy for profitability:

  • OHI has a better Return On Assets (2.47%) than 71.88% of its industry peers.
  • OHI has a Return On Equity of 6.34%. This is amongst the best in the industry. OHI outperforms 80.47% of its industry peers.
  • OHI's Return On Invested Capital of 3.08% is fine compared to the rest of the industry. OHI outperforms 62.50% of its industry peers.
  • The Profit Margin of OHI (27.21%) is better than 81.25% of its industry peers.
  • In the last couple of years the Profit Margin of OHI has grown nicely.
  • OHI has a better Operating Margin (41.72%) than 87.50% of its industry peers.
  • The Gross Margin of OHI (98.15%) is better than 98.44% of its industry peers.
